📐 Pattern Specifications

  • Skill Level: Beginner

  • Sizes Included: 4, 5, 6, 7

  • Features: Traditional shape, easy ties, simple finish, optional lace edging for a decorative touch

  • Seam Allowance: Included

  • Notion: 23.6" / 60 cm of narrow edging cotton lace, 0.7" width (optional) — a sweet way to dress up the apron and give it an authentic costume feel.

🪡 Fabrics That Work Best

This apron shines in wovens such as:

Light to mid-weight fabrics like Calico, Quilting Cotton, Lawn, Poplin, Baby Cord, and Flannel make this pattern both comfortable and sturdy for active little ones.
